什么叫s3对象存储,深入解析S3对象存储的优势与应用
- 综合资讯
- 2024-10-27 17:14:21
- 3

S3对象存储是一种基于云的对象存储服务,允许用户存储和检索大量数据。其优势在于高可靠性、可扩展性和灵活性,支持多种编程语言和工具的访问。S3广泛应用于数据备份、归档、大...
S3对象存储是一种基于云的对象存储服务,允许用户存储和检索大量数据。其优势在于高可靠性、可扩展性和灵活性,支持多种编程语言和工具的访问。S3广泛应用于数据备份、归档、大数据分析、媒体处理等场景,提供数据持久化、灾难恢复和全球访问等功能。
随着互联网技术的飞速发展,数据量呈爆炸式增长,传统的存储方式已经无法满足企业对海量数据存储和管理的需求,S3对象存储作为一种新型存储方式,凭借其独特的优势,成为了当前存储领域的主流选择,本文将从S3对象存储的定义、优势、应用等方面进行深入解析。
S3对象存储的定义
S3对象存储,全称为Simple Storage Service,是亚马逊云服务(Amazon Web Services,简称AWS)提供的一种对象存储服务,它允许用户将数据以对象的形式存储在云端,并通过RESTful API进行访问和管理,S3对象存储具有高度的可扩展性、高可用性、安全性和低成本等特点。
S3对象存储的优势
1、高度可扩展性
S3对象存储具有无限的可扩展性,可以轻松应对海量数据的存储需求,用户可以根据实际需求调整存储容量,无需担心存储空间不足的问题,S3对象存储采用分布式存储架构,可以自动将数据分散存储在不同的物理节点上,确保数据的安全性和可靠性。
2、高可用性
S3对象存储采用多区域复制和自动故障转移机制,确保数据的高可用性,当某个区域发生故障时,系统会自动将数据复制到其他区域,保证数据不丢失,S3对象存储支持跨区域访问,用户可以随时随地访问自己的数据。
3、安全性
S3对象存储提供了丰富的安全功能,包括数据加密、访问控制、审计日志等,用户可以根据自己的需求设置访问权限,确保数据的安全性和隐私性,S3对象存储还支持跨账号共享数据,方便用户进行数据共享和协作。
4、低成本
与传统存储方式相比,S3对象存储具有较低的成本,S3对象存储采用按量付费模式,用户只需为实际使用的存储空间和带宽付费;S3对象存储具有高性价比的存储介质,降低了存储成本。
5、易用性
S3对象存储提供了丰富的API接口和工具,方便用户进行数据存储、管理和访问,用户可以通过编程语言或命令行工具访问S3对象存储,实现数据的自动化管理,S3对象存储还支持与AWS其他服务进行集成,方便用户构建复杂的云上应用。
S3对象存储的应用
1、数据备份和归档
S3对象存储可以用于数据的备份和归档,将重要的数据存储在云端,确保数据的安全性和可靠性,S3对象存储的低成本特性使得数据备份和归档变得更加经济实惠。
2、大数据存储和分析
S3对象存储可以用于存储和分析大数据,用户可以将海量数据存储在S3对象存储中,利用AWS大数据服务进行数据挖掘和分析,从而发现有价值的信息。
3、云端应用开发
S3对象存储可以用于云端应用开发,为开发者提供数据存储和访问服务,开发者可以通过编程语言或命令行工具访问S3对象存储,实现数据的存储、管理和访问。
4、分布式存储和计算
S3对象存储可以与AWS的其他服务进行集成,如Amazon EC2、Amazon EMR等,实现分布式存储和计算,用户可以利用S3对象存储存储海量数据,同时利用AWS的其他服务进行数据分析和处理。
S3对象存储作为一种新型存储方式,凭借其高度可扩展性、高可用性、安全性和低成本等优势,成为了当前存储领域的主流选择,随着互联网技术的不断发展,S3对象存储将在更多领域得到广泛应用,为企业和个人提供更加便捷、高效的数据存储和管理服务。
本文链接:https://www.zhitaoyun.cn/372073.html
发表评论